Rostec disclosed plans to substantially scale up the production of Obereg body armor vests in response to sustained demand. The information surfaced through Rostec-related channels on a Telegram briefing space dedicated to company news. Rostec did not publish exact figures, but it is understood that the production volume will reach roughly two thousand bulletproof vests per quarter, with output projected to grow significantly in iterative cycles through the year. According to the organization, the 2024 production level is set to rise many times above what was achieved in 2023, reflecting a strategic push to expand manufacturing capacity and meet ongoing needs for enhanced personal protection gear.

The Obereg vest is manufactured at Rostec’s Octava facility in Tula, with production having begun in the spring of 2023. The developer claims that the vest can absorb a direct hit from B-32 armor-piercing rounds, underscoring its intended role in challenging field conditions. The product design centers on a chest plate composed of ceramic elements designed to absorb the kinetic energy of incoming projectiles, combined with a high molecular plastic layer that delivers Br5 class protection. In testing scenarios, the plate endured three hits from B-32 armor-piercing rounds fired from a sniper rifle at a ten-meter distance, and withstood two additional strikes using less powerful ammunition, illustrating its validated resilience across common engagement ranges.

Rostec’s update comes amid broader efforts within Russia to bolster defense-related manufacturing capabilities. Earlier developments in the defense tech sector included the creation of a new drone suppression system, signaling a broader push to advance protective technologies and countering capabilities in well-defined submarkets. Rostec’s emphasis on domestic production aligns with strategic goals to expand in-country supply chains for critical equipment and to ensure timely provisioning for security and defense needs.
